Contact the supplierHand washing (or handwashing), also known as hand hygiene, is the act of cleaning one's hands with soap (or equivalent materials) and water to remove viruses/ bacteria/germs/ microorganisms, dirt, grease, or other harmful and unwanted substances stuck to the hands.Drying of the washed hands is part of the process as wet and moist hands are more easily recontaminated.

Contact the supplierWashing hands with soap and water is the best way to get rid of germs in most situations. If soap and water are not readily available, you can use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er that contains at least 60% alcohol. You can tell if the sanitizer contains at least 60% alcohol by looking at the product label.
